Miss Reynolds to wed McIntosh on June 5

The engagement and forthcoming marriage of Elizabeth Reynolds of Ridgely and Andrew McIntosh of Bolivar are being announced today.
The bride-elect is the da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Jim W. Reynolds of Milan. She is the granddaughter of Katherine Webb of Spring Hill, Fla., the late Robert Webb and the late Alton and Evon Reynolds.
She is a 2001 graduate of Milan High School. She received a bachelor’s degree in elementary education in 2005 and a master’s degree in education in 2007 from the University of Tennessee at Martin. She is employed with the Lake County School System as a kindergarten teacher in Ridgely.
The groom-elect is the son of Rick and Sheila Stone of Troy. He is the grandson of Mr. and Mrs. Earl McIntosh and Mr. and Mrs. Edward Corcoran, all of Michigan, and Virginia Stone and the late Dudley Stone of Hornbeak.
He is a 1996 graduate of Obion County Central High School. He received a bachelor’s degree in music in 2002 from UT Martin. He is working toward his master’s degree in Christian studies at Union University in Jackson and is employed with Hardeman County School System as the band director at Bolivar Middle School.
The couple will exchange vows at 6:30 p.m. June 5 at the home of the groom’s parents in Troy. Music will begin at 6 p.m.
All friends and family are invited to attend.
Only out-of-town invitations are being sent.
